Protest action: M19 closed between Westville and Umgeni
Updated | By Shaun Ryan
Durban's Metro Police have been dispatched to several protests, thought to be over service delivery issues, in and around the city this morning.
The M19 has been closed to traffic in both directions between Roger Sishi Road in Westville and Reservoir Hills and the new Umgeni Road interchange.
Metro says motorists will need to bypass the area by travelling through Westville via Spaghetti Junction and the N3.
Traffic on the N2 near the old airport, south of Durban has also been affected on both carriageways.
Motorists travelling from Amanzimtoti towards Durban are being advised to rather use the M4 freeway.
Meanwhile, Metro says officers are also monitoring unrest along Himalayas Road near Swinton Road in Mobeni.
